->A female knight who hails from the [[FictionalCountry kingdom of Wolfkrone]]. Having been in charge of Wolfkrone since her father went Berserk, she's been defending it from Nightmare for a long time. After Siegfried's appearance in town, she took it as an omen and decided to lead a full-scale attack behind him, hoping for ultimate victory. She returned in ''Soulcalibur V'', now traveling with Siegfried's band of mercenaries after Wolfkrone fell into darkness. She has also apparently become a mother, but the identity of her children's father is unknown.
